The Gist Yoon Se-ri Son Ye-jin has spent the past decade building a very successful fashion company, and she has a flair for the dramatic. When paparazzi catch her holding hands with a pop star, her only concern is that the earrings sheâs wearing arenât blurred out on the photos. Though Se-ri has been estranged from her family, who runs one of South Koreaâs biggest conglomerates, her father Jeung-pyeong Nam Kyung-eup orders that she come home to see him after heâs released on probation from prison on securities fraud charges. Despite the fact that her brothers Se-joon Choi Dae-hoon and Se-hyung Park Hyung-soo are still involved in the country and have been aiming to succeed their father as chairman for years, Jeung-pyeong decides that Se-ri will take over for him, because she actually runs a successful business. Of course, everyone, including her mother Jeong-yeon Bang Eun-jin, is shocked, when Se-ri accepts. But first she has a very important sportswear test to perform. The next day, she goes to a mountainous area to test a jumpsuit her company designed; she wants to go paragliding, much to the dismay of her manager, Hong Chang-sik Go Kyu-pil. She goes out and is enjoying the peace when she gets caught up in a sudden tornado and is deposited, mostly unharmed, in a tree. On the North Korean side of the DMZ, Captain Ri Jung-hyuk Hyun Bin is leading a patrol unit about to switch out of the intense deployment at the DMZ. Heâs loyal but has integrity, which he shows when the South catches people from the North who crossed to plunder artifacts. He is appalled when Armed Forces Security Bureau officer Jo Cheol-kang Oh Man-seok tells him that the three will get off lightly they donât. As he patrols the fence to search for tornado damage, he spots Se-ri caught in that tree. He orders her to jump down, and she literally lands on him. At first Se-ri thinks Jung-hyuk is a defector, but then she realizes that she somehow landed in North Korea. She goes to run, but he warns her that the woods are full of scattered mines, right before he steps on one himself. As heâs frozen in place, she runs and he lets her; she somehow evades his patrol, the border guard, and all the mines, and jumps a fence she thinks will lead her home. When she goes into the first town she sees, she realizes sheâs even deeper into the North than she realized; Captain Ri follows her there and finds her. Photo Netflix Our Take One of the things we noticed with Korean romance dramedies is that it usually involves a situation where two unexpected people fall for each other, or where one of the romantic leads is thrust into an unfamiliar situation where he or she has to hide, impersonate someone else, or otherwise conceal their true identity. Crash Landing On You Original title Sarangui Bulsichak is in the âhidingâ category, where Captain Ri is going to hide Se-ri in that North Korean town so sheâs not found out and sent to prison. Of course theyâll probably fall in love and there will be all sorts of complications. But the most interesting complicating factor is how a woman who was about to ascend to a powerful position in the business world of South Korea will have to abide by how people â women in particular â live in North Korea, which is more akin to the 1950s than the 2020s. So, in the middle of this romantic comedy there will be some sociopolitical themes that we donât tend to see in shows like this. Will Se-ri prompt Captain Ri to defect and join her in Seoul? And, considering that her family has issues that are reminiscent of the Roys in Succession, how will her reappearance shake things up? And there are things going on with her family, like Se-hyung trying to get restitution from a young businessman named Goo Seung-joon Kim Jung-hyun, who ripped him off. Se-joonâs issue is that his wife Do Hye-ji Hwang Woo-seul-hye is putting all her hopes on the idea that Se-joon will be the chairman. Those aspects of the story are touched upon in the 76-minute first episode, and theyâll likely be explored more as the season goes on two episodes premiere each week, on Fridays and Saturdays. But for now, those stories are underdeveloped in the face of having to cover Captain Ri and Se-riâs stories. But thereâs potential there for those stories to get better. Sex and Skin Nothing. Locations Filmed Apart from South Korea, the drama was also filmed in Switzerland and Mongolia. Despite its premise, Crash Landing On You did not utilise North Korea as a filming location. All makeshift landscapes were re-created in places such as Jeju in Korea, amidst other locations. I mean, you do know that, right? These iconic steps didnât mean that South Koreans could just step into North Korea for a drama Highest TvN rating in history According to Soompi, the series finale of the hit drama set a new record for the highest viewership ratings in tvN history, with an average nationwide rating of percent and a peak rating of percent. The previous record was set by Goblin back in January 2017, when its finale achieved a peak rating of percent. Image Crash Landing On You is now the second-highest rated drama in South Korean cable television history, with a peak AGB Nielsen rating of percent. Sky Castle, a drama about South Korean âtiger mumsâ, is in first place having achieved a peak rating of percent in February 2019. And lest youâre not aware, Sky Castle is also available in Netflix. According to Wikipedia, the production of the drama proved to be âpainstakingly meticulousâ, owing to the countryâs tense relationship with North Korea. Because the crew lacked a â guidebook on multiple hurdles he had to hop over â skillfully and delicately â to accurately depict the country while dodging criticismâ, they had to be careful not to misrepresent the state. Apart from guidance by North Koreans residing in South Korea, as well as general research, the crew also worked with North Korean defector turned film advisor and writer Kwak Moon-wan, who joined the dramaâs writing team. Kwak, who learnt film directing in Pyongyang and had been a member of an elite security force protecting the Kims, helped to craft the dramaâs plot, and assisted in conceptualising the setting and scenes in the drama depicting everyday North Korea life. Image According to North Korean defector-turned-YouTuber and reality TV celebrity Kang Nara, around 60% of the portrayal of North Korea is accurate. âThe richer families in North Korea like to show off their wealth by adding lace curtains to their windows. So that was pretty well portrayed,â she commented Wait, only 60%? I felt like I was in Kim Jong-Unâs land just by watching it. Inspiration As it turns out, the freak accident that left Yoon Se-ri stranded in North Korea might not have been a mere fictional gimmick. According to The Straits Times, Screenwriter Park Ji-Eun drew inspiration from actress Jung Yangâs 2008 accident the actress was sailing in Incheon when her boat was swept away due to harsh weather conditions, causing her to almost cross the 38th parallel⊠The border between North and South Korea. Controversy Crash Landing On You mightâve won legions of fans around the globe, but its success didnât come without controversy. After the dramaâs premiere, Crash Landing On You was accused of âglamorisingâ the reclusive state. And thatâs not all. Police Report Made for the Drama On 9 Jan, the conservative Christian Liberty Party from South Korea, lest youâre wondering filed a police complaint under the premise that the drama had violated National Security Law. It claims that the drama has only depicted North Korean soldiers in a âpeacefulâ way, and that South Korean citizens have been âincitedâ by the TV series. âOur security law stipulates we should not sympathize with an anti-government organization that threatens the nationâs existence,â the statement reads. âWe want the instigators to be promptly investigated and punished.â Seoul Metropolitan Police Agency is currently reviewing the complaint, but many believe that the cable channel is unlikely to be punished. âFiction-based dramas have rarely been punished for breaking the security law,â a police agency official said.
